Randolph gets vote of confidence from Mets brass

Willie Randolph has the confidence of management

NEW YORK, NY — Embattled New York Mets manager Willie Randolph got a much-needed vote of confidence from the team’s front office this week.

“I took Willie aside, and I told him that I’d heard a lot of bad stuff about him, and about the situation with our club,” said GM Omar Minaya. “I said, ‘Willie, I want to give you a vote of confidence. I want to be very clear – I’m extremely confident that you will be able to find a new job.’ And you know what? I think it made him feel a lot better about himself.”

Minaya said that his confidence in Randolph was based in large part on the fact that Randolph has been the manager of a major league baseball team in one of the biggest markets there is.

“Granted, he probably won’t be able to find a job managing a major league team,” Minaya said. “He’s clearly not qualified to do that. But his experience here should definitely make him a top candidate for a job as a pitching coach in AA, or maybe even as a manager in rookie ball – something like that.”

Minaya said Randolph welcomed the vote of confidence with relief.

“It’s crazy economic times right now, and so Willie was understandably concerned,” he explained. “It’s not easy to just go out and find a new job, even if you were successful at your last job. If you weren’t, it’s even harder – and let me tell you something, as a manager, Willie Randolph blows. So he would fall in the not successful category.”

Randolph said that the meeting was “productive,” but didn’t get him everything he’d hoped for.

“Omar was very confident in my ability to get a new job,” Randolph said. “So I appreciated that vote of confidence. But he was a lot less forthcoming when I asked him about selling my house. He kept saying things like, ‘It’s a down market,’ and ‘You have a subprime mortgage,’ and stuff like that. I would have loved to get some confidence about that, but I guess you have to take what you can get.”

But Minaya said he’s also confident that Randolph will enjoy his new life.

“He’ll get a decent gig, I’m sure of it. Or, worst case, he can go to ESPN, and tell everyone about everything that they don’t know but that he does know,” Minaya said. “Steve Phillips seems to enjoy that.”
